Baked Macaroni and Cheese Recipe cheesesticks
- 12 oz. Macaroni noodles
- 2 tbs. butter
- 1/4 cup flower
- 2 cups milk
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2 cup John Wm. Macys Melting Parmesan CheeseSticks
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ees
- Fill a large pot with water and bring to a boil.
- Slowly drop in the macaroni noodles and cook for 5 to 7 minutes.
- Remember to occasionally stir the noodles to avoid sticking.
- In a separate pan melt 2 tbs.
- butter.
- Once the butter has melted add 1/4 cup flower and mix together.
- Then add the milk and cheddar cheese.
- Stir until smooth
- Once the noodles have been cooked and drained, add in the cheese mixture.
- This is a great time to add salt and pepper and season it to your liking.
- In a small sealed bag, crush 2 cups of John Wm.
- Macys Melting Parmesan Cheesesticks and set aside.

- Pour the macaroni and cheese mixture into a baking dish.
- Add the crushed parmesan CheeseSticks to the top of the dish.
- Place in the oven and bake for 15 minutes or until the top is golden brown.
